| // Returns the stack consumption in bytes for the code exercised by
 | |
| // signal_handler.  To measure stack consumption, signal_handler is registered
 | |
| // as a signal handler, so the code that it exercises must be async-signal
 | |
| // safe.  The argument of signal_handler is an implementation detail of signal
 | |
| // handlers and should ignored by the code for signal_handler.  Use global
 | |
| // variables to pass information between your test code and signal_handler.
 | |
| int GetSignalHandlerStackConsumption(void (*signal_handler)(int));
